Understanding Tire Sizes and Types for 4Runner TRD Off Road
When it comes to choosing the right tires for your 4Runner TRD Off Road, understanding the different tire sizes and types is crucial. The 4Runner TRD Off Road typically comes with 265/70R17 or 265/65R18 tires, but you may want to consider upgrading to larger or smaller tires depending on your driving needs. Larger tires can provide better traction and ground clearance, but may affect your vehicle’s fuel efficiency and handling. On the other hand, smaller tires can improve fuel efficiency and handling, but may compromise on traction and ground clearance.
It’s also important to consider the type of tire you need, such as all-terrain, mud-terrain, or highway tires. All-terrain tires are a good all-around choice, providing a balance of traction, durability, and fuel efficiency. Mud-terrain tires, on the other hand, are designed for extreme off-road use and provide maximum traction in muddy and rocky terrain. Highway tires are designed for on-road use and provide a smooth, quiet ride and good fuel efficiency.
In addition to tire size and type, you should also consider the tire’s load rating, speed rating, and tread depth. The load rating indicates the maximum weight the tire can support, while the speed rating indicates the maximum speed the tire can handle. The tread depth indicates the amount of tread remaining on the tire, with deeper treads providing better traction and longer tire life.
When choosing tires for your 4Runner TRD Off Road, it’s also important to consider the climate and terrain you’ll be driving in. If you live in an area with extreme weather conditions, such as heavy snow or rain, you may want to consider tires with specialized tread compounds and designs to provide better traction and control. Similarly, if you’ll be driving in rocky or muddy terrain, you may want to consider tires with aggressive tread patterns and reinforced sidewalls to provide better protection and durability.

Tread Pattern and Depth
Another critical factor to consider when buying tires for your 4Runner TRD Off Road is the tread pattern and depth. The tread pattern refers to the design of the tire’s tread, including the grooves, lugs, and sipes. A good tread pattern can provide excellent traction, handling, and braking performance. The tread depth, on the other hand, refers to the depth of the tire’s tread, measured in thirty-seconds of an inch. A deeper tread depth can provide better traction and longer tread life.
The tread pattern and depth you choose will depend on your driving conditions and preferences. If you drive in wet or snowy conditions, a tire with a tread pattern that includes circumferential grooves and lateral grooves can provide excellent hydroplaning resistance and traction. If you drive in muddy or rocky terrain, a tire with a more aggressive tread pattern and deeper tread depth can provide better traction and durability. It is essential to consider your driving needs and choose a tire with a tread pattern and depth that can handle the terrain you drive on most frequently.

What is the difference between all-terrain and mud-terrain tires?
All-terrain tires and mud-terrain tires are both designed for off-road use, but they have some key differences. All-terrain tires are designed to provide a balance between on-road and off-road performance. They have a more moderate tread pattern and are designed to handle a variety of terrain, including paved roads, dirt roads, and light off-roading. Mud-terrain tires, on the other hand, are designed specifically for extreme off-road use and have a more aggressive tread pattern. They are designed to handle deep mud, rocks, and other challenging terrain.
Mud-terrain tires are generally more expensive than all-terrain tires and may not provide as smooth of a ride on paved roads. However, they offer superior traction and control in extreme off-road conditions. All-terrain tires, on the other hand, are a good choice for those who want a tire that can handle both on-road and off-road use. They are generally less expensive than mud-terrain tires and provide a smoother ride on paved roads. By considering your specific needs and driving habits, you can choose the best type of tire for your 4Runner TRD Off Road.

How often should I rotate my tires on my 4Runner TRD Off Road?
It’s recommended to rotate your tires on your 4Runner TRD Off Road every 5,000 to 8,000 miles. Regular tire rotation can help to extend the life of your tires and improve their performance. It can also help to prevent uneven wear and tear, which can lead to a loss of traction and control. By rotating your tires regularly, you can ensure that they wear evenly and provide a safe and stable ride.
You should also check your owner’s manual for specific recommendations on tire rotation for your 4Runner TRD Off Road. Some vehicles may have different recommendations for tire rotation, so it’s important to follow the manufacturer’s guidelines. Additionally, you should also check your tires regularly for signs of wear and tear, such as uneven wear, cracks, or bulges. By catching any problems early, you can prevent them from becoming major issues and ensure a safe and smooth ride.
